Who was Chris Horning?

Chris Horning was a remarkable football player at Columbine High School. He showed his outstanding athletic prowess and represented the school in various regional and local championships by wearing his jersey number 9. He was elected by all-Jeffco selection and coached by Andry Lowry. His prowess was recorded by a 4.72 40-yard dash, 335 bench, and 4.6 shuttle.
